Elm Tree Removal in Doylestown, PA
Elm t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of mature or unwanted elm trees from residential or commercial properties. These projects often include removing dead, diseased, or hazardous trees that pose safety risks or interfere with property use. Property owners typically seek this service when an elm tree has become structurally compromised, is causing obstructions, or needs to be cleared for new landscaping or construction plans. Understanding the scope of removal, including potential impacts on the landscape and surrounding structures, is important before requesting assistance.
Before requesting elm tree removal, property owners should consider factors such as the size and location of the tree, proximity to buildings or utility lines, and any permits or regulations that may apply in Doylestown, PA. It is also helpful to understand the process involved, including stump grinding and cleanup, as well as any potential effects on the landscape or nearby vegetation. Clear communication about these details can ensure the removal process aligns with property goals and safety considerations.

Elm Tree Removal Questions
When is Elm Tree removal necessary? Removal may be needed if the tree is dead, diseased, or poses a safety risk due to damage or instability.
What signs indicate an Elm Tree needs to be removed? Signs include extensive decay, large cracks, or root damage that affects the tree's stability.
Can Elm Trees be removed without harming surrounding plants? Proper removal techniques aim to minimize impact on nearby landscaping and vegetation.
What should property owners consider before Elm Tree removal? It's important to evaluate the tree's condition and potential effects on property safety and aesthetics.
